Agreement Enables SAFC to Deliver Key Chemistries for DNA and RNA Synthesis



ST. LOUIS, Mo., May 21 / -- SAFC, a member of the Sigma-Aldrich Group (NASDAQ:SIAL), announced today that its Supply Solutions business segment has received a license for Beckman Coulter's (NYSE:BEC) fast deprotection chemistry. The agreement covers Beckman Coulter's acetyl-protected cytidine DNA- and 2'-O-methyl phosphoramidites for the synthesis of oligonucleotides. These chemistries collapse cleavage and deprotection timelines to mere minutes, while completely maintaining the integrity of synthesized DNA and RNA.



SAFC is the first company licensed to the full range of these phosphoramidites, which will be produced at their Proligo® Reagents ISO 9001-certified manufacturing facility in Hamburg, Germany. The licensing agreement expands SAFC's oligo synthesis reagents offer in the sector. The agreement coincides with the U.S. TIDES® 2007 conference being held in Las Vegas, Nevada on May 20 - 23, 2007.

About SAFC: SAFC is the custom manufacturing and services group within Sigma-Aldrich that focuses on high-purity inorganics for high technology applications, cell culture products and services for biopharmaceutical manufacturing, biochemical production and the manufacturing of complex, multi-step organic synthesis of APIs and key intermediates. SAFC has manufacturing facilities around the world dedicated to providing manufacturing services for companies requiring a reliable partner to produce their custom manufactured materials. SAFC has four operating segments -- SAFC Pharma, SAFC Supply Solutions, SAFC Biosciences, and SAFC Hitech -- and had annual sales of nearly $500 million in 2006. SAFC is one of the world's 10 largest fine chemical businesses.

About Beckman Coulter:

Beckman Coulter, Inc., based in Fullerton, California, develops, manufactures and markets products that simplify, automate and innovate complex biomedical tests. More than 200,000 Beckman Coulter systems operate in laboratories around the world supplying critical information for improving patient health and reducing the cost of care. Recurring revenue, consisting of supplies, test kits, service and operating-type lease payments, represents more than 75 percent of the company's 2006 annual revenue of $2.53 billion.
